Before we tag the Gridsmith 2.4 release, note that the fill solver now backtracks on two-letter slots instead of rejecting the grid outright. This cut generation failures on the Thornquay puzzle pack by roughly half in my local runs, but it does raise average solve time. Nothing user-facing changes unless the timeout trips. The solver limits shipping with this build are as follows.

tuning table, kajog-bawip:
TIERS = {
    "kelius": 256,
    "lammir": 543,
}

- [ ] **Step 7: Breaker override escrow.** After sealing the signing keys for the Tallgrove upstream API circuit breaker, confirm the support team can force the breaker open during a full outage. The override bundle lives in the sealed escrow drawer and is useless without its unlock phrase. Two ceremony witnesses must initial this step before proceeding. The escrow bundle is decrypted with the recovery passphrase that follows.

vault phrase of kahip-kahop = holath-quenmir

Subject: Handover — Brindlecache postmortem follow-ups

Hey Mora,

Wrapping up before my rotation ends, so here's where things stand for the release manager's sign-off. The stale-cache bug from the Pellworth launch is documented; root cause was the invalidation job silently skipping shards after a failover. I've added a verification query that counts stale rows hourly — results land in the `cache_audit` schema. Please keep an eye on it through Thursday's release. To run the checks yourself, connect with the string below.

primary connection of fahag-kawig = mysql://gilath_svc:ycU1T0imceeaI4@db-27dd.norvastack.example:5432/silwyn

# Service Account: taxcache-reader

The TariffBox cache stores jurisdiction tax rates pulled hourly from the Ledgerline rate service. Reads go through the `taxcache-reader` account; writes are refresh-job only. Do not query Ledgerline directly — always hit the cache. Cache misses fall through automatically. For local dev, the reader authenticates to the cache API with the key below.

service key, fawip-bajef: kto11_Qt5wZK9vdNC

**Handover: laundry-locker access flow (TumbleGate)**

Support: I'm rotating off this area. Known issue — locker PINs at the Marrow Street site occasionally expire early; workaround is reissuing from the admin console. Escalation doc is in the team wiki. All access-flow escalations now go to the engineer named below.

named custodian: Brivan Eliath Quenox Frador